Commander Quote by Aristotle
““he who had never learned to obey cannot be a good commander””
About This Quote
Source Treatise: Politics, Book III, 4th century BC
A commander must first learn obedience; without it, leadership lacks discipline and respect.
In simple terms: Obedience is prerequisite for good command.
